Abstract

The paper is a general review of Information Wave’s (IW) ideologies. IW is an ongoing process of political (ideological), economic, social, and technical configurations and relations. Conflicted IW ideologies must be reconciled. The interests of info-economic utility and social justice need to be balanced. Social awareness of IW must be promoted. A healthy and peaceful living can be achieved by simultaneous promotion of localized economies and identities and globalized consciousness. International institutions, led by the United Nations, must take on new roles and adopt new strategies to build up a dynamic and creative relationship between the need for a global market and the needs of the small entities. Further knowledge that gives permanence and stability to the moral standards, which afford reasonable scope for genuine adjustments, adaptations and innovations, must be advanced. It makes morality reign supreme for ICT developers, operators, users and policy makers; and ensures that the affairs of life, instead of dominated by self-centered desires and interests, are regulated by norms of morality.
